In 1841, Rufus Smith entered the world in Harrison Co. MS, born to Sherrod Smith And Maria Bond. In 1880, Rufus Smith resided in Red Creek and Wolf River, Marion, Mississippi, Uni. In 1900, Rufus Smith resided in Police Jury Ward 3, Vernon, Louisiana, USA. Rufus Smith married Jane Bond Smith, and had children including Adolfus Putnam Smith, Albert Tyre Smith, Amanda M Smith, Clemmie Martha Jane Smith, George Lafette Smith, Julia M Smith, Laura O Dora Smith, Lou Smith, Louisa Ophelia Smith, Lucien Monroe Smith, Maggie Smith, Rufus Henry Smith, Tarrie Smith, William Taylor Smith. Rufus Smith passed away in 1922 in Evans, La.
